After receiving complaints from a mother about the chilling sight of the Black Eyed Child at Cannock Chase in Staffordshire, paranormal investigator Lee Brickley has launched a detailed investigation into the case.

The unsettling sighting of the ghostly image has been reported ahead of Halloween which is just a month away generating fear among the locals, Paranormalcannock reported.

"Around 2 months ago my daughter and I were walking through Birches Valley (an area well known for it's spectral sightings) when we heard the screams of a young child. I couldn't tell if it was a boy or a girl, but they definitely seemed in distress and sounded very close to us, so we instantly started running towards the noise," the mother with the pseudo name Mrs Kelly wrote in her email to Brickley.

"We couldn't find the child anywhere and so stopped to catch our breath, that's when I turned round and saw a girl stood behind me, no more than 10 years old, with her hands over her eyes," continued.

"She then put her arms down by her side and opened her eyes, which is when I saw they were completely black, no iris, no white, nothing. I jumped back and grabbed my daughter, when I looked again, the child was gone," her mail concluded.

Brickley, who runs a website for paranormal investigations, has claimed that nearly 30 years ago the scary child was spotted by one of his relatives at the same spot.

"In the summer of 1982, my auntie was 18 years old. She and her friends would often meet and "chill" (her word, not mine) on Cannock Chase in the evening time" the paranormal investigator wrote in his blog.
